17-2711. Corporate name.

17-2711. Corporate name. The corporate name of a corporation organized and operating hereunder may be any name not contrary to law or the ethics of the profession involved. Such name may include any name set forth in K.S.A. 17-6002 , and amendments thereto, but in all cases the corporate name shall end with the word "chartered" or "professional association" or the abbreviation "P.A." or "PA". The abbreviations "P.A." and "PA" shall be considered to be identical.
